Nicolas Duboc <[EMAIL PROTECTED]> wrote: [...] > Is a new tarball with clear copyright notices mandatory for Debian ?
Not as far as I know, but I wouldn't be surprised for ftp-masters to reject a tarball without them. As a minimum, I'd snapshot http://sourceforge.net/projects/ht2html into debian/copyright for this. > Would an email stating the copyright and licensing status of ht2html be > sufficient ? Yes, if it's clearly the wish of all copyright holders. However, as most of ht2html has no copyright notices, I think you need them to state that they are all of the ht2html copyright holders, too. This is icky. > Is there any other solution ? Probably, but I can't think of a better one.
